Unbeatable Durability: Granite's Toughness
When we talk about the advantages of granite countertops, the first thing that usually pops into people's minds is just how darn tough they are. Seriously, guys, granite is a natural stone formed over millions of years under intense heat and pressure deep within the Earth. This means it's incredibly hard and durable. We're talking about a material that can withstand a lot of the daily grind that kitchens throw at it. Spills, hot pans, dropped utensils – granite can handle it. It scores a 7 on the Mohs scale of hardness, which is pretty impressive, making it resistant to scratches. While it's not indestructible (no countertop really is, let's be real), it's significantly more scratch-resistant than many other materials. This durability means your granite countertops will likely look fantastic for years, even decades, to come, resisting chips and cracks with proper care. Heat Resistance: Cooking Without Fear
Alright, fellow kitchen enthusiasts, let's talk about heat! If you do a lot of cooking, you know that sometimes things get hot, fast. One of the major advantages of granite countertops is their excellent heat resistance. Because granite is a natural stone that’s formed under extreme heat, it can handle high temperatures pretty well. This means you can often place hot pots and pans directly from the stove or oven onto your granite surface without worrying about scorching or damaging it. Now, while it's super heat-resistant, it's always a good idea to use trivets or hot pads as a precaution, especially for extremely hot or prolonged heat exposure, just to be safe and keep your countertops looking pristine for as long as possible. But compared to materials like laminate or some solid surfaces, granite is a champion when it comes to handling heat. This feature is a game-changer for busy kitchens. Low Maintenance: Easy to Keep Clean
Let’s be honest, guys, after a long day, the last thing anyone wants is a high-maintenance countertop. This is where granite truly shines! One of the most significant advantages of granite countertops is their low maintenance requirements. Once properly sealed, granite is highly resistant to stains. That means spills from wine, coffee, oil, or juice are less likely to soak into the stone and leave unsightly marks. A quick wipe-down with a damp cloth and a mild detergent is usually all it takes to keep them clean and sparkling. Unlike porous materials that require constant attention and special cleaning products, granite is relatively forgiving. The sealing process, which typically needs to be done periodically (usually once a year or every few years, depending on the sealant and usage), creates a barrier that further protects the stone. For everyday cleaning, just use a soft cloth, warm water, and a pH-neutral cleaner. Avoid harsh chemicals like bleach or ammonia, as they can degrade the sealant over time. Hygienic Surface: Less Germs, More Peace of Mind
Let's talk about health and safety in the kitchen, guys. In today's world, we're all a bit more conscious of cleanliness, and this is another area where granite excels. One of the often-overlooked advantages of granite countertops is their hygienic nature. When properly sealed, granite becomes non-porous, meaning it doesn't easily absorb liquids or harbor bacteria. This is a huge plus for any kitchen environment where food preparation takes place. Unlike softer, more porous materials that can become breeding grounds for germs, a sealed granite surface offers a much cleaner and safer place to chop vegetables, prepare meals, and serve food. The smooth, hard surface is also easy to sanitize effectively. Regular cleaning with appropriate disinfectants will keep your countertops germ-free.
